OpenArt

AI art generator and model hub for creating images from text prompts.

Pros

  • +Access to many different art generation models
  • +Workflow and prompt-editing tools included
  • +Active community sharing prompts and styles
  • +Useful for exploring varied artistic styles

Cons

  • Quality varies significantly by chosen model
  • Can be overwhelming with so many options
  • Heavier use requires paid credits

SeaArt

AI art generator offering anime and photoreal model styles.

Pros

  • +Strong anime and stylized art model selection
  • +Active community sharing prompts and styles
  • +Free tier for casual use
  • +Good variety between anime and photoreal outputs

Cons

  • Photorealistic quality trails specialized leaders
  • Community content moderation varies
  • Heavier use requires paid credits
